WebBut no, 2 associates is not equivalent to 1 bachelors. I recommend finishing your bachelors now because it will never be easier to do than now. Some companies are very set in their ways and require bachelors degrees, even if you have a decade or more of experience. One day your dream job may come along but may require that degree. WebMar 26, 2024 · For example, imagine you’re able to graduate from high school with your associate’s degree due to dual enrollment. Then you enroll in a university that charges $15,000 in tuition per year. Two years later, you graduate with your bachelor’s degree–effectively saving $30,000 (two years) in tuition cost. Associate’s degrees are often cheaper than bachelor’s degrees due to the shorter amount of time they take to complete. Although the cost of the program will depend on which college you attend, an associate’s degree typically costs two to three times less than a bachelor’s degree.

In the U.S. educational system, bachelor's degree recipients have 16 years of formal education — 12 years of elementary and secondary education plus four years of post-secondary study — which qualify them for admission to advanced degree programs.
